Candidates must hold a Master’s degree in the relevant subject with at least 55% marks from a recognized university or possess an equivalent qualification. Academic Qualification (Subject) : For the disciplines of Botany, Chemistry, Commerce, Economics, Education, English, Geography, Hindi, History, Home Science, Mathematics, Military Science (Defence Studies), Philosophy, Physical Education, Physics, Political Science, Psychology, Sanskrit, Sociology, Urdu, Zoology, Statistics, Computer Science and Persian. Must have qualified UGC NET or possess a Ph.D. as per UGC regulations. All candidates must read the official information completely before applying.

Why Should I Consider a Government Job?

Job Security and Stability: Government jobs are known for their stability and long-term security. Unlike many private sector positions, they provide a sense of confidence and protection for the future.

Attractive Benefits and Perks: Employees often receive healthcare coverage, retirement plans, paid leave, housing allowances, and various additional benefits that support overall well-being.

Career Growth: Regular salary increments, promotions based on experience, and professional development opportunities help employees achieve long-term career success.

Work-Life Balance: Government jobs typically offer fixed working hours, flexible leave policies, and a healthy balance between professional and personal life.
